It's safe to say that most drivers take their brakes for granted. You press on the brake pedal and the vehicle slows down or stops. It's easy to see why it is so important for your vehicle's brakes to be working correctly. Brakes are an important safety feature of any vehicle.
When it comes to your brakes working correctly, maintaining them regularly will ensure that you will always be able to slow or stop your vehicle in any situation, whether on a sunny day on dry pavement or a bad weather day on slippery surfaces. And that is why regular brake service is such a sound investment for all drivers. The combo of brakes" and "surprises" doesn't usually end well.
You might already know about some of the parts of your braking system. Terms familiar to you might be pads, rotors, and calipers. In short, the calipers press the pads, which in turn contact the rotors. The resulting friction slows your vehicle. Another type of brake uses a drum and brake shoes. But both count on friction to work.
When you come in to have us check your brakes, we'll make sure those parts are all in good working together and meet the specifications of your vehicle manufacturer. But there are other important components as well. Your brake system has several parts of a hydraulic system that uses fluids to conduct the pressure you put on the brake pedal to the brakes on all of your wheels. There are hoses and lines that can sometimes degrade because of road salt or debris.
Last and not least, your vehicle has an emergency or parking brake. It's something you'll need to prevent your vehicle from rolling when you park on a steep incline. Your parking brake also is an important backup if your hydraulic brakes fail.
